Directed by Hollywood stage veteran DAVID GALLIGAN and produced by Palm Springs based REACTION PRODUCTIONS, the acclaimed, versatile performer, LESLIE JORDAN, has built his resume’ predominantly in television and films, returns to the stage, having conquered the other performance mediums on the strength of his own unique character and convictions. His adroit, one-of-a-kind Southern branded humor and innate storytelling abilities have brought Jordan legions of new fans.

Jordan is best known for his innumerable television appearances both as a series regular and guest star. Along with his portrayal of the irascible nemesis to Karen Walker, Beverley Leslie on Will & Grace, he has registered memorable guest stints in an array of television’s best known series such as Boston Legal, Ugly Betty and Reba. Equal acclaim has come from Jordan’s hilarious, poignant and humane portrayals on stage and film. His most enduring turn as Brother Boy in the hit cult film classic Sordid Lives as well as his one-man autobiographical stage renderings “Like a Dog on Linoleum” and “Hysterical Blindness and other Southern Tragedies That Have Plagued My Life Thus Far” have hailed Jordan with well deserved accolades for his unique emotional voice.

2008 is shaping up to be a banner year for the comedic actor from Chattanooga. He is currently nearing completion on the initial season of his new cable series entitled “12 Miles of Bad Road”, co-starring alongside comedy genius LILY TOMLIN and popular fellow Southerner MARY KAY PLACE. Advance buzz on this new venture has been extraordinary. The new series completed production in Spring 2008 as he then immediately segued into preparations for the new Pink Carpet stage production which premiered in San Diego and will culminate in Provincetown, MA. It is also based upon his additional latest conquest; this time as a published author. Having taken feathered plume to hand to commit to pages (and the Ages), his first book tentatively titled “My Trip Down the Pink Carpet”, an autobiographical compilation of witticisms and wisdoms he has collected along his colorful life course. The “trip” is saturated with star encounters as well; show biz legends BETTY WHITE, CLORIS LEACHMAN and FAYE DUNAWAY along with contemporaries GEORGE CLOONEY, MEGAN MULALLHY, DELTA BURKE, BILLY BOB THORTON, JOHN RITTER and ROBERT DOWNEY JR. make his written journey a true “cause celebre” and are mixed in memorably with his encounters in a colorful assortment of family, friends and bands of “gypsies, tramps and thieves” all of whom Jordan is more than willing to “Cher”.

Published by SIMON & SCHUSTER, Inc., the narrative voice is unmistakable, vintage Jordan, doing what he does best; traipsing his way down the path he was destined to take, with no apologies and fewer regrets. In the process, Jordan hits more than a few potholes along the way while rendering a life experience filled with raucous humor, wild abandon, trials and tribulations and anecdotal tidbits that are often painfully honest but forthrightly shared with the integrity only a man of his spiritually awakened sense and resolve could possess. And to his undeniable. devotion and credit to his Southern upbringing.

Scheduled to visit 28 cities throughout North America, “My Trip Down the Pink Carpet” will continue throughout Spring and early Summer 2008. Play dates for the show, accompanying book signings and special appearances will include the major urban centers of America and continuing through the Heartland, the Deep South and beyond to the capitols of neighboring Canada.
